    Here's the simple way to explain it.....
    We don't tell you that you need oxygen. But when you are told you need oxygen, we help you look at why you were told that and how you can fit doing the things to get oxygen into your daily habits and what are the barriers to you doing those and then brainstorm together ways to overcome those barriers. And then we keep accountability on these things.

    If you can make suggestions, then isn’t that practically the same as advice? And isn’t the implementation of a behavioral change process predicated on the notions that come from you as the coach and your opinions and suggestions?

    • @michellemaclean
      @michellemaclean  Рік тому

      Giving a couple suggestions to your client is different from advising, recommending and telling them what to do. It gives them a few options and then they can decide what they want to do with the suggestions. They don't have to take them at all. That is the coach approach. We honour that the client know what's best for them. We are not medical experts.
